iphone - 如何将文本的第一个字母大写

标签 iphone objective-c cocoa-touch

文本字段中有一些文本。在设置为 txtfdName 之前,我想将第一个字母大写。

[addrecipe.txtfdName setText:txtfield1.text];

最佳答案

使用 autocapitalizationType 作为 UITextField 的大写字母。

txtfield1.autocapitalizationType = UITextAutocapitalizationTypeWords;

关于iphone - 如何将文本的第一个字母大写,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5788228/

相关文章:

ios - UIStatusBarStyleBlackOpaque 和 UIStatusBarStyleBlackTranslucent 尽管从 iOS 7.0 开始被弃用,但仍然可能吗?

ios - UIModalPresentationFormSheet 中的 UITextView 卡住应用程序 iOS 10

objective-c - 在混合 objc/swift 模块中,Xcode 总是尝试包含模块本身

iphone - 如何同步调用 NSStream

iphone - 如何编辑 CGImage 中像素的 alpha

iphone - iOS – 将录音保存到应用文档

iphone - MPMusicPlayerController 和 setNowPlayingItem

iphone - AVMutableVideoComposition 中的淡入淡出

iPhone sdk,在后台运行应用程序并发送频繁的http请求

html - 样式在 Chrome 和 Firefox Safari 和 iPhone 中显示不同